Neighborhood Overview

Fiesta Bowling Center is nestled within the vibrant community of Hot Springs Village, a master-planned community located in Garland County, Arkansas, about an hour southwest of Little Rock. Its address on Highway 7 North places it conveniently along a main thoroughfare, making it accessible from various points within the village and surrounding areas. The primary access route is Highway 7, which connects to larger state highways, facilitating travel to and from nearby cities like Hot Springs. Parking is typically ample and directly adjacent to the center, with dedicated spots for bowlers. The nearest significant airport is Bill and Hillary Clinton National Airport (LIT) in Little Rock, approximately a 60-minute drive via Highway 7 and Interstate 30. Driving is the most practical way to reach Fiesta Bowling Center, as public transportation options are limited in this region. To avoid the usual local traffic patterns, especially during peak hours or community events, it’s wise to plan your arrival a little earlier than usual, giving yourself time to find parking and get settled.

Garvan Woodland Gardens

8.2 mi

Discover the stunning beauty of Garvan Woodland Gardens, the botanical garden of the University of Arkansas. Located on a peninsula on Lake Hamilton, this expansive garden features themed areas, architecturally significant structures like the Anthony Chapel, and a tranquil environment. It's a perfect place for a leisurely stroll, offering beautiful scenery and a peaceful escape. Allow at least a couple of hours to fully appreciate the diverse plant collections and picturesque views.

Lake Ouachita State Park

12.6 mi

Experience the natural splendor of Lake Ouachita, one of the cleanest and most beautiful lakes in the United States. Lake Ouachita State Park offers opportunities for swimming, boating, fishing, and hiking. You can explore miles of shoreline, enjoy scenic overlooks, and discover the park's diverse wildlife. It's an ideal destination for outdoor enthusiasts looking to connect with nature, offering a refreshing contrast to indoor activities like bowling.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Hot Springs Village is cool to mild, with average daytime temperatures in the 40s and 50s Fahrenheit. Evenings can drop below freezing. Visitors should pack layers, including sweaters, jackets, and perhaps a light scarf. Rain is common, and occasional frost or light snow can occur, though heavy accumulation is rare. Comfortable indoor shoes are essential for bowling, and waterproof footwear is advisable for any outdoor excursions.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ring brings warming temperatures, generally ranging from the 60s to 70s Fahrenheit, with increasing sunshine. Early summer continues this trend, often reaching the 80s. This is a great time for outdoor activities, but also perfect for the air-conditioned comfort of the bowling alley. Pack light clothing, but be prepared for cooler evenings or sudden rain showers with a light jacket or sweater.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er (July and August) is typically hot and humid, with temperatures frequently in the 90s Fahrenheit and high humidity. Indoor venues like Fiesta Bowling Center become particularly appealing during these months. Visitors should dress in light, breathable fabrics. Hydration is key for any outdoor activity, and even short walks between the car and the center can feel warm.

🍂

Fall season

Fall is a beautiful time with gradually cooling temperatures, typically ranging from the 70s in early fall down to the 50s by late November. The air becomes crisp, and the foliage puts on a spectacular display. This season is excellent for enjoying both outdoor sights and indoor comforts. Pack layers, including light jackets and long-sleeved shirts, for comfortable outings and bowling sessions.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is possible year-round in Hot Springs Village, often arriving in scattered showers or more prolonged periods, especially in spring and fall. Snow is infrequent and usually light, melting quickly. When rain is in the forecast, ensure your footwear has good traction, and consider bringing an umbrella. Bowling offers a dry and entertaining alternative on any wet weather day.
